package ifc.container;
import com.sun.star.container.XNamed;
import lib.MultiMethodTest;
import util.utils;
/**
* Testing <code>com.sun.star.container.XNamed</code>
* interface methods :
* <ul>
* <li><code> getName()</code></li>
* <li><code> setName()</code></li>
* </ul>
* This test need the following object relations :
* <ul>
* <li> <code>'setName'</code> : of <code>Boolean</code>
* type. If it exists then <code>setName</code> method
* isn't to be tested and result of this test will be
* equal to relation value.</li>
* <ul> <p>
* Test is <b> NOT </b> multithread compilant. <p>
* @see com.sun.star.container.XNamed
*/
public class _XNamed extends MultiMethodTest {
public XNamed oObj = null; // oObj filled by MultiMethodTest
/**
* Test calls the method and checks return value and that
* no exceptions were thrown. <p>
* Has <b> OK </b> status if the method returns non null value
* and no exceptions were thrown. <p>
*/
public void _getName() {
// write to log what we try next
log.println("test for getName()");
boolean result = true;
boolean loc_result = true;
String name = null;
loc_result = ((name = oObj.getName()) != null);
log.println("getting the name \"" + name + "\"");
if (loc_result) {
log.println("... getName() - OK");
} else {
log.println("... getName() - FAILED");
}
result &= loc_result;
tRes.tested("getName()", result);
}
/**
* Sets a new name for object and checks if it was properly
* set. Special cases for the following objects :
* <ul>
* <li><code>ScSheetLinkObj</code> : name must be in form of URL.</li>
* <li><code>ScDDELinkObj</code> : name must contain link to cell in
* some external Sheet.</li>
* </ul>
* Has <b> OK </b> status if new name was successfully set, or if
* object environment contains relation <code>'setName'</code> with
* value <code>true</code>. <p>
* The following method tests are to be completed successfully before :
* <ul>
* <li> <code> getName() </code> : to be sure the method works</li>
* </ul>
*/
public void _setName() {
String Oname = tEnv.getTestCase().getObjectName();
String nsn = (String) tEnv.getObjRelation("NoSetName");
if (nsn != null) {
Oname = nsn;
}
if ((Oname.indexOf("Exporter") > 0) || (nsn != null)) {
log.println("With " + Oname + " setName() doesn't work");
log.println("see idl-file for further information");
tRes.tested("setName()", true);
return;
}
requiredMethod("getName()");
log.println("testing setName() ... ");
String oldName = oObj.getName();
String NewName = (oldName == null) ? "XNamed" : oldName + "X";
String testobjname = tEnv.getTestCase().getObjectName();
if (testobjname.equals("ScSheetLinkObj")) {
// special case, here name is equals to links URL.
NewName = "file:///c:/somename/from/XNamed";
} else if (testobjname.equals("ScDDELinkObj")) {
String fileName = utils.getFullTestDocName("ScDDELinksObj.sdc");
NewName = "soffice|" + fileName + "!Sheet1.A2";
} else if (testobjname.equals("SwXAutoTextGroup")) {
//This avoids a GPF
NewName = "XNamed*1";
}
boolean result = true;
boolean loc_result = true;
Boolean sName = (Boolean) tEnv.getObjRelation("setName");
if (sName == null) {
log.println("set the name of object to \"" + NewName + "\"");
oObj.setName(NewName);
log.println("check that container has element with this name");
String name = oObj.getName();
log.println("getting the name \"" + name + "\"");
loc_result = name.equals(NewName);
if (loc_result) {
log.println("... setName() - OK");
} else {
log.println("... setName() - FAILED");
}
result &= loc_result;
oObj.setName(oldName);
} else {
log.println("The names for the object '" + testobjname +
"' are fixed.");
log.println("It is not possible to rename.");
log.println("So 'setName()' is always OK");
result = sName.booleanValue();
}
tRes.tested("setName()", result);
}
}
